Evaluate the Limit limit as x approaches infinity of 6

Problem

(lim_x→∞)(6)

Solution

  1. Identify the function being evaluated, which is the constant function ƒ(x)=6

  2. Apply the limit law for constants, which states that the limit of a constant as x approaches any value (including infinity) is simply the constant itself.

  3. Conclude that since the value of the expression does not depend on x it remains unchanged as x grows larger.

Final Answer

(lim_x→∞)(6)=6
